| { | |
| "model_name": "meta-llama/Llama-3.2-3B-Instruct", | |
| "task_type": "CAUSAL_LM", | |
| "training_parameters": { | |
| "num_epochs": 1, | |
| "batch_size": 8, | |
| "learning_rate": 0.0002, | |
| "max_length": 1024, | |
| "num_warmup_steps": 128 | |
| }, | |
| "lora_config": { | |
| "r": 16, | |
| "lora_alpha": 32, | |
| "lora_dropout": 0.1, | |
| "bias": "none", | |
| "target_modules": [ | |
| "q_proj", | |
| "k_proj", | |
| "v_proj", | |
| "o_proj", | |
| "gate_proj", | |
| "up_proj" | |
| ] | |
| }, | |
| "training_results": { | |
| "final_training_loss": 2.3811, | |
| "final_validation_loss": 2.2514, | |
| "final_training_perplexity": 10.82, | |
| "final_validation_perplexity": 9.5, | |
| "total_steps": 8012, | |
| "training_time_hours": 8.1 | |
| }, | |
| "hardware": { | |
| "platform": "TPU v3-8", | |
| "framework": "PyTorch + torch_xla", | |
| "environment": "Kaggle" | |
| } | |
| } |
